Why Live Stations Outlast Trends
At first glance, live stations seem like a novelty. But their continued popularity proves otherwise. The appeal lies in their timeless qualities: freshness, interaction, and human connection. Watching a chef prepare in real time appeals to the senses and creates a sense of anticipation that pre-prepared trays cannot match.
In the long term, this format promotes sustainability. Food is cooked in smaller batches, reducing waste. Ingredients stay fresher for longer, and organisers can manage portions more effectively. The adaptability of the live station model ensures that it stays relevant without overhauling the entire catering concept.

The Longevity of Freshness
Singapore’s workforce is increasingly health-conscious, and this has influenced catering preferences. Heavy, oily meals are giving way to lighter, fresher alternatives. Live stations naturally fit this evolution. Because food is prepared to order, guests can customise portion sizes, skip certain ingredients, or request healthier options like less oil or extra vegetables.
This flexibility makes live stations a sustainable fixture in seminar catering. They align with modern wellness priorities without sacrificing flavour or excitement. Caterers can offer balanced menus that energise rather than exhaust. The longevity of an event concept often depends on how well it adapts to changing lifestyles, and the live station does just that.
